Practice Overview

Our organization is affiliated with a leading cancer center in Buffalo, NY, and will employ physicians within the hematology/oncology program. Physicians typically see between 15 to 18 patients daily, with the option to increase this volume if desired. Advanced Practice Providers (APPs) manage around 10 to 12 patients each day. During hospital rounds, physicians do not have patient responsibilities.

Average Daily Patient Volume:

  • Hospital Census: 20-30 patients
  • Albany Clinic: 50-80 patients
  • Troy Clinic: 40 patients

Infusion visit volumes average 30-38 patients per day in Albany and 15-20 in Troy. Both nurses and APPs are authorized to administer antineoplastic agents, while MDs and APPs handle intrathecal, intralesion, and intracavity procedures. Bone marrow and fine needle aspiration biopsies are primarily conducted by Interventional Radiology, and nurses manage vascular access devices. Intrapleural therapies are provided in inpatient settings. Our organization is actively pursuing clinical trials in collaboration with the cancer center.

The oncology service line consists of approximately 80% oncology and 20% benign hematology, with a transition towards a 1:1 MD to APP model.

Patient Demographics

We serve a diverse patient population across various socio-economic backgrounds, with ages ranging from geriatric to young adult (no pediatrics). The practice sees high volumes of pancreatic, breast, colon, and urological cases, while melanoma and renal cases are less frequent. Our physicians have access to a wide range of specialties within the healthcare system, including Thoracic, GI, Head & Neck, and Genitourinary. The GI group operates independently but collaborates effectively with our oncology service line. Please note that we do not manage acute leukemias or have a Bone Marrow Transplant/Transitional Care program at this time.

Support Staff

Our nursing team achieved Magnet designation in 2022. Each physician is assigned a primary nurse responsible for triage calls and paperwork. Dedicated nurses are available in both the Albany and Troy clinics to assist with patient management. We also have four full-time pharmacists on staff who are approachable and ready to assist with any questions regarding chemotherapy.

Call Responsibilities

The call schedule is set at 1:5 for inpatient consults, with a future goal of 1:7. Hospitalists handle patient admissions, while dedicated inpatient APPs manage ongoing care. After-hours call occurs Monday through Thursday every five weeks, with weekend responsibilities from Friday to Sunday on the same rotation.

Electronic Medical Records: EPIC

Tumor Boards: We host tumor boards for GU, GI, Breast, Thoracic, and General oncology, with virtual access to specialized tumor boards from the cancer center.
